Multi-Vehicle Collision Disrupts Traffic on I-15

Phelan, February 11, 2025 -

A traffic collision involving three vehicles occurred today on the northbound lanes of Interstate 15 at State Route 138 in Phelan, CA. The incident, which initially reported no injuries, later confirmed that one individual sustained unknown injuries and required medical attention.

The vehicles involved included a Kia Soul, an unknown color pickup truck, and an unknown color sedan. Emergency services responded quickly to the scene, where the Kia Soul was towed due to damage. The collision blocked the slow lane on the State Route 138 off-ramp, causing traffic disruptions in the area.

Reports indicate that the Kia Soul collided with the pickup truck and the sedan, leading to a chain reaction involving multiple vehicles. Emergency responders worked diligently to manage the situation, ensuring the safety of all involved and clearing the roadway.

By 7:09 AM, a tow truck arrived to remove the Kia Soul from the scene, while medical personnel transported the individual with unknown injuries for further evaluation. Traffic flow was impacted during the incident, but responders aimed to restore normal conditions as quickly as possible.
